#70cdc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70cdc4 is composed of 43.9% red, 80.4%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 174.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 62.2%. #70cdc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#009b89.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#70cdc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70cdc4 has RGB values of R:112, G:205,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7392708.

Shades and Tints of #70cdc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#70cdc4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da0a0 is the less saturated color, while #43fae8 is the most saturated one.
